cppillr (cpluspiller) is an experimental tool to analyze C++ code.
This software is in beta stage, it's useless in its current state, so please don't expect stability or usefulness. Use it at your own risk.
cppiller [command] [-options...] [files...]
Commands:
cppiller run file.cpp: Tries to compile and run the givenfile.cppfile (and its dependencies)cppiller docs: Creates a markdown file with the documentation of the given files (Doxygen-like?)
Global Options:
-filelist file.txt: The given file.txt must contain a list of files to be readed. It's like passing through the command line all the paths inside the given file.txt.-showtokens: For debugging purposes: It shows the tokens of all input files.-showincludes: For debugging purposes: It shows the #include files of all the input files.-counttokens: Prints a counter of the read number of tokens.-countlines: Prints a counter of the number of lines with tokens (non-blank lines).-keywordstats: Prints a counter for each kind of token used in the input files.
